73,363,261,309,205,631 is an odd composite number composed of three prime numbers multiplied together.

What does the number 73363261309205631 look like?

This visualization shows the relationship between its 3 prime factors (large circles) and 8 divisors.

73363261309205631 is an odd composite number. It is composed of three dist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of eight divisors.

Prime factorization of 73363261309205631:

3 × 1206743 × 20264812339
